RoleAssignmentScheduleRequest interface
Solicitud de programación de asignación de roles
Propiedades
| approval |
ApprovalId de la solicitud de programación de asignación de roles. NOTA: Esta propiedad no se serializará. Solo el servidor puede rellenarlo. |
| condition | Condiciones de la asignación de roles. Esto limita los recursos a los que se puede asignar. Por ejemplo: @Resource[Microsoft.Storage/storageAccounts/blobServices/containers:ContainerName] StringEqualsIgnoreCase 'foo_storage_container' |
| condition |
Versión de la condición. El valor aceptado actualmente es '2.0' |
| created |
DateTime cuando se creó la solicitud de programación de asignación de roles NOTA: Esta propiedad no se serializará. Solo el servidor puede rellenarlo. |
| expanded |
Propiedades adicionales de la entidad de seguridad, el ámbito y la definición de roles NOTA: esta propiedad no se serializará. Solo el servidor puede rellenarlo. |
| id | Identificador de solicitud de programación de asignación de roles. NOTA: Esta propiedad no se serializará. Solo el servidor puede rellenarlo. |
| justification | Justificación de la asignación de roles |
| linked |
Identificador de programación de idoneidad del rol vinculado: para activar una idoneidad. |
| name | Nombre de la solicitud de programación de asignación de roles. NOTA: Esta propiedad no se serializará. Solo el servidor puede rellenarlo. |
| principal |
Identificador de entidad de seguridad. |
| principal |
Tipo de entidad de seguridad del identificador de entidad de seguridad asignado. NOTA: Esta propiedad no se serializará. Solo el servidor puede rellenarlo. |
| requestor |
Id. del usuario que creó esta solicitud NOTA: Esta propiedad no se serializará. Solo el servidor puede rellenarlo. |
| request |
Tipo de la solicitud de programación de asignación de roles. Por ejemplo: SelfActivate, AdminAssign, etc. |
| role |
Identificador de definición de rol. |
| schedule |
Información de programación de la programación de asignación de roles |
| scope | Ámbito de solicitud de programación de asignación de roles. NOTA: Esta propiedad no se serializará. Solo el servidor puede rellenarlo. |
| status | Estado de la solicitud de programación de asignación de roles. NOTA: Esta propiedad no se serializará. Solo el servidor puede rellenarlo. |
| target |
Identificador de programación de asignación de roles resultante o identificador de programación de asignación de roles que se actualiza. |
| target |
Identificador de instancia de programación de asignación de roles que se está actualizando |
| ticket |
Información de vale de la asignación de roles |
| type | Tipo de solicitud de programación de asignación de roles. NOTA: Esta propiedad no se serializará. Solo el servidor puede rellenarlo. |
Detalles de las propiedades
approvalId
ApprovalId de la solicitud de programación de asignación de roles. NOTA: Esta propiedad no se serializará. Solo el servidor puede rellenarlo.
approvalId?: string
Valor de propiedad
string
condition
Condiciones de la asignación de roles. Esto limita los recursos a los que se puede asignar. Por ejemplo: @Resource[Microsoft.Storage/storageAccounts/blobServices/containers:ContainerName] StringEqualsIgnoreCase 'foo_storage_container'
condition?: string
Valor de propiedad
string
conditionVersion
Versión de la condición. El valor aceptado actualmente es '2.0'
conditionVersion?: string
Valor de propiedad
string
createdOn
DateTime cuando se creó la solicitud de programación de asignación de roles NOTA: Esta propiedad no se serializará. Solo el servidor puede rellenarlo.
createdOn?: Date
Valor de propiedad
Date
expandedProperties
Propiedades adicionales de la entidad de seguridad, el ámbito y la definición de roles NOTA: esta propiedad no se serializará. Solo el servidor puede rellenarlo.
expandedProperties?: ExpandedProperties
Valor de propiedad
id
Identificador de solicitud de programación de asignación de roles. NOTA: Esta propiedad no se serializará. Solo el servidor puede rellenarlo.
id?: string
Valor de propiedad
string
justification
Justificación de la asignación de roles
justification?: string
Valor de propiedad
string
linkedRoleEligibilityScheduleId
Identificador de programación de idoneidad del rol vinculado: para activar una idoneidad.
linkedRoleEligibilityScheduleId?: string
Valor de propiedad
string
name
Nombre de la solicitud de programación de asignación de roles. NOTA: Esta propiedad no se serializará. Solo el servidor puede rellenarlo.
name?: string
Valor de propiedad
string
principalId
Identificador de entidad de seguridad.
principalId?: string
Valor de propiedad
string
principalType
Tipo de entidad de seguridad del identificador de entidad de seguridad asignado. NOTA: Esta propiedad no se serializará. Solo el servidor puede rellenarlo.
principalType?: string
Valor de propiedad
string
requestorId
Id. del usuario que creó esta solicitud NOTA: Esta propiedad no se serializará. Solo el servidor puede rellenarlo.
requestorId?: string
Valor de propiedad
string
requestType
Tipo de la solicitud de programación de asignación de roles. Por ejemplo: SelfActivate, AdminAssign, etc.
requestType?: string
Valor de propiedad
string
roleDefinitionId
Identificador de definición de rol.
roleDefinitionId?: string
Valor de propiedad
string
scheduleInfo
Información de programación de la programación de asignación de roles
scheduleInfo?: RoleAssignmentScheduleRequestPropertiesScheduleInfo
Valor de propiedad
scope
Ámbito de solicitud de programación de asignación de roles. NOTA: Esta propiedad no se serializará. Solo el servidor puede rellenarlo.
scope?: string
Valor de propiedad
string
status
Estado de la solicitud de programación de asignación de roles. NOTA: Esta propiedad no se serializará. Solo el servidor puede rellenarlo.
status?: string
Valor de propiedad
string
targetRoleAssignmentScheduleId
Identificador de programación de asignación de roles resultante o identificador de programación de asignación de roles que se actualiza.
targetRoleAssignmentScheduleId?: string
Valor de propiedad
string
targetRoleAssignmentScheduleInstanceId
Identificador de instancia de programación de asignación de roles que se está actualizando
targetRoleAssignmentScheduleInstanceId?: string
Valor de propiedad
string
ticketInfo
Información de vale de la asignación de roles
ticketInfo?: RoleAssignmentScheduleRequestPropertiesTicketInfo
Valor de propiedad
type
Tipo de solicitud de programación de asignación de roles. NOTA: Esta propiedad no se serializará. Solo el servidor puede rellenarlo.
type?: string
Valor de propiedad
string